Abstract

Systems and methods for providing wagering games associated with an underlying game of baccarat which are configured for receiving a wager relating to the associated wagering game; conducting the underlying game of baccarat until a baccarat outcome is achieved according to the rules of the baccarat game, wherein the baccarat outcome includes data relating to a player hand score, a banker hand score, the number of cards in the player hand, and the number of cards in the banker hand; comparing the baccarat outcome data with preset criteria, wherein the preset criteria includes at least a number of playing cards for at least one of the respective player and banker hands, a numerical score for at least one of the respective player or banker hands, and a relationship between the player and banker hands; and providing a payout if the preset criteria is satisfied by the baccarat outcome data.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 .- 21 . (canceled) 
     
     
         22 . A method of providing a wagering game associated with an underlying game of baccarat, comprising the steps of:
 a) receiving a wager relating to the associated wagering game;   b) receiving baccarat outcome data from an instance of conducting the underlying game of baccarat using a set of randomly-ordered physical playing cards, a plurality of the randomly-ordered playing cards being distributed to form a single player hand and a single banker hand, respectively, until a final condition for the single player hand and the single banker hand, and an outcome in the instance of conducting the underlying game of baccarat are achieved, wherein the baccarat outcome includes data relating to the final condition of the single player hand and the single banker hand, including a player hand numerical score, a banker hand numerical score, a number representing the amount of physical playing cards in the final player hand, and a number representing the amount of physical playing cards in the final banker hand;   c) comparing the baccarat outcome data with preset criteria, wherein the preset criteria identifies at least a specific number representing the amount of physical playing cards which must be in at least one of the respective final player and banker hands, a specific numerical score for at least one of the respective final player and banker hands, and a specific relationship between the final player hand numerical score and the final banker hand numerical score defined by any of the baccarat outcome data received;   d) providing a payout if the preset criteria is satisfied by the underlying game outcome data; and   e) collecting the wager if the preset criteria is not satisfied by the underlying game outcome data.   
     
     
         23 . The method as recited in  claim 22 , wherein the preset criteria includes a single number of physical playing cards in the player hand, a single numerical score for the player hand and a player hand score which is greater than the banker hand score but less than the highest score possible in baccarat. 
     
     
         24 . The method as recited in  claim 23 , wherein the number of physical playing cards is 3. 
     
     
         25 . The method as recited in  claim 23 , wherein the score is 8. 
     
     
         26 . A method of providing a wagering game associated with an underlying game of baccarat, comprising the steps of:
 a) receiving a wager relating to the associated wagering game;   b) a processor for facilitating the random ordering of a set of physical playing cards from one or more decks of standard playing cards in a card shuffling apparatus, and providing the subsequent set of randomly-ordered physical playing cards for use in the play of an instance of the underlying game of baccarat to generate baccarat outcome data;   c) receiving baccarat outcome data from an instance of conducting the underlying game of baccarat in which a plurality of physical playing cards are dealt from the randomly-ordered set of physical playing cards to a single player hand and a single banker hand, respectively, until the single player hand and single banker hand are in a final condition and an outcome in the underlying game of baccarat is achieved, wherein the baccarat outcome includes data relating to the final condition of the single player hand and the single banker hand involved in the underlying game of baccarat, including a player hand numerical score, a banker hand numerical score, a number representing the amount of physical playing cards in the final player hand, and a number representing the amount of cards in the final banker hand;   d) comparing the baccarat outcome data with preset criteria, wherein the preset criteria identifies at least a specific number representing the amount of physical playing cards which must be in at least one of the respective final player and banker hands, a specific numerical score for at least one of the respective final player and banker hands, and a specific relationship between the final player hand numerical score and the final banker hand numerical score defined by any of the baccarat outcome data received;   e) providing a payout if the preset criteria is satisfied by the underlying game outcome data; and   f) collecting the wager if the preset criteria is not satisfied by the underlying game outcome data.   
     
     
         27 . The method as recited in  claim 26 , wherein the preset criteria includes a single number of physical playing cards in the player hand, a single numerical score for the player hand and a player hand score which is greater than the banker hand score but less than the highest score possible in baccarat. 
     
     
         28 . The method as recited in  claim 27 , wherein the number of physical playing cards is 3. 
     
     
         29 . The method as recited in  claim 27 , wherein the score is 8. 
     
     
         30 . A method of providing a wagering game associated with an underlying game of baccarat, comprising the steps of:
 a) receiving a wager relating to the associated wagering game;   b) receiving baccarat outcome data from an instance of conducting the underlying game of baccarat using a set of randomly-ordered physical playing cards, a plurality of the randomly-ordered playing cards being distributed to form a single player hand and a single banker hand, respectively, until a final condition for the single player hand and the single banker hand, and an outcome in the instance of conducting the underlying game of baccarat are achieved, wherein the baccarat outcome includes data relating to the final condition of the single player hand and the single banker hand, including a player hand numerical score, a banker hand numerical score, a number representing the amount of physical playing cards in the final player hand, and a number representing the amount of physical playing cards in the final banker hand;   c) comparing the baccarat outcome data with preset criteria, wherein the preset criteria identifies at least a specific number representing the amount of physical playing cards which must be in at least one of the respective final player and banker hands, a specific numerical score for at least one of the respective final player and banker hands, wherein the player hand score must be greater than the banker hand score but less than the highest score possible in baccarat;   d) providing a payout if the preset criteria is satisfied by the underlying game outcome data; and   e) collecting the wager if the preset criteria is not satisfied by the underlying game outcome data.   
     
     
         31 . The method as recited in  claim 30 , wherein the preset criteria includes a single number of playing cards in the player hand and a single numerical score for the player hand. 
     
     
         32 . The method as recited in  claim 31 , wherein the number of playing cards is 3. 
     
     
         33 . The method as recited in  claim 31 , wherein the score is 8.
